  7. I bought my bike in Springfield, Mo. and I live in the Texas panhandle. The only warranty work I have had done on the bike was a leak in the radiator, but the Amarillo, Tx. dealer had no problem. I am thinking a Yamaha warranty is a Yamaha warranty. The dealer is reimbursed by Yamaha for their labor. I would give it a shot. I think the warranty covers dealer installed accessories, you don't really have much to lose by checking. Here is what Yamaha says about their warranty, doesn't say you have to return it to the dealer your purchased it from. THE PERIOD OF WARRANTY for the Yamaha Royal Star or Venture including windshield, saddlebags, and mounting hardware and/or audio equipment installed as original equipment, shall be five (5) years from the date of purchase, regardless of mileage. MODELS EXCLUDED FROM WARRANTY include those used for non-Yamaha authorized renting, leasing, or other commercial purposes. DURING THE PERIOD OF WARRANTY any authorized Yamaha motorcycle dealer will, free of charge, repair or replace, at Yamaha’s option, any part adjudged defective by Yamaha due to faulty workmanship or material from the factory. Parts used in warranty repairs will be warranted for the balance of the product’s warranty period. All parts replaced under warranty become the property of Yamaha Motor Corporation, U.S.A. GENERAL EXCLUSIONS from this warranty shall include any failures caused by: a. Competition of racing use. b. Installation of parts or accessories that are not qualitatively equivalent to genuine Yamaha parts. c. Abnormal strain, neglect, or abuse. d. Lack of proper maintenance or storage. e. Accident or collision damage. f. Modification to original parts. g. Damage due to improper transportation.

  9. Khrome Werks are quality pipes, in my opinion. To go back to stock pipes, remove saddle bags (4 bolts on each) loosen clamps (1 clamp on each pipe), then there is 1 bolt holding each pipe on. Pull pipes off bike and go back in reverse order. Doesn't take long. Also, gives you a chance to inspect rear tire etc. I found a 4" crack in the sidewall of my rear tire not long ago that I would not have seen with the bags on.
